Garena Free Fire


Garena Free Fire is a battle royale game created and released by Garena company for Android and Pc. It is the most downloaded game globally during 2019-2021. The sport received the award for the "Best Popular Vote Game" by the Google Play Store in 2019. In May 2020, Free Fire has done the record with 80 million users active daily globally. In November 2019, Free Fire has grossed over $1 billion users globally.


Gameplay:


Garena Free Fire is an online-only action-adventure battle royale game played from a person's perspective.


50 players falling from a parachute on land to find guns and attachments to kill enemies. Players may select their starting position, take guns and equipment to make a good battle.


Players start matchmaking then they're in a plane, flying on the island. When the plane is flying through the island, the players jump out from the plane and find their favorite place, thus allowing them to settle on a strategic place to land far away from enemies. After arriving, the players have to find weapons and other items. Equipment, guns, grenades, and other items found on the island. The last alive player or squad wins the match. The sport had received a serious update on Monday, December 7, 2020, that brought changes to the training ground because it introduced some updated guns. The sport received its next major patch update on Pan American Day 2021 which introduced a replacement map Bermuda Remastered permanently and a replacement in-game weapon Kord during this update.


Reception:


In the Google Play annual list of "Best Apps of the Year", Free Fire won within the "Best Popular Vote Game" category of 2019, being the foremost publicly voted in Brazil and in Thailand.


Garena Free Fire is one among the foremost popular battle royale mobile games, behind PUBG Mobile, Fortnite Battle Royale, and Call of Duty: Mobile. It's particularly popular in Latin American, India, and Southeast Asia. It grossed approximately $19.3 million in monthly revenues through December 2018, becoming a big financial success for Garena. In February 2020, Free Fire has downloaded by 500 million users.


At the end of Q1 2021, Free Fire surpassed PUBG Mobile in revenues within the US, generating $100 million in turnover as compared to PUBG's $68 million. Free Fire's revenues jumped by 4.5x as compared to an equivalent period for the previous year.
